Many travelers are caught off guard by roaming charges in Cape Verde. Despite its popularity with European tourists, this stunning archipelago is an African nation and is not part of the European Union. This means your 'Roam Like at Home' benefits from carriers like Vodafone UK or Orange Portugal will not apply. Expect exorbitant 'Rest of World' roaming fees if you rely on your home SIM.
